Soft Tissue Thickness on Submerged and Non Submerged Implants

Changes in the marginal bone level surrounding the implant are the frequently used parameters in assessing the short- and long-term success. Multiple biological and biomechanical factors have been reported to adversely affect marginal bone level. Recently, initial vertical mucosal tissue thickness has also been reported to have an impact on bone stability.The hypothesis of present study is that soft tissue thickness on implant placement has no positive impact of crestal bone remodeling.

About this study

The aim of this study is to evaluate the clinical and radiographical results of submerged and nonsubmerged implants with thin (<3 mm) and thick (>3 mm) soft tissue over 1.5 year after implant placement. All submerged and nonsubmerged implants were randomly placed as split-mouth. Clinical periodontal parameters were recorded. Crestal bone levels were analyzed from the day of implants inserted to 1.5 year after prosthetic loading on digitally standardized radiographs. Non-parametric test were used for statistically analysis.

Inclusion criteria

  • being older than 18 years of age
  • generally healthy patients, no medical contraindication for implant surgery
  • missing teeth in upper jaw posterior and more than one tooth in neighbourhood area
  • no bone augmentation procedures before and during implant placement.

Exclusion criteria

  • poor oral hygiene
  • history of periodontitis
  • smoking
  • diabetes
  • alcoholism
  • taking medication which interferes soft and hard tissue healing
  • bruxism.
